11/7/10 Delhi

Puri Chana for breakfast!  Oh yeah!  Deep fried fluffy dough served with curried dal, curried potatoes, picked chutney and a salad of purple onions, cucumbers and green chilies.  That and a coffee drink was enough to last me till dinner.  Since we have an open day until our driver takes us to Jaipur and Agra, Marie and I decide to take the Metro to Connaught Place, Delhi's premier shopping district.  The efficient Metro was easy enough to tackle and was fairly pleasurable.  Connaught Place on the other hand was a disappointment.  With the sidewalks in disrepair and a lack of high end shops, it didn't measure up to my idea of "premier" for the capitol of India.  I guess I'm just spoiled when it comes to high end malls (i.e. Stanford Mall, Santana Row, Philippines' Makati Mall, London's Oxford Circle and Harrod's Dept Store. etc).

One great thing about Delhi besides the history, multitude of historical monuments, temples, palaces all of which easily out date the birth of America are the clean and well maintained streets.  Through my personal experiences thus far in India, I've seen a gross amount of trash littered all over the roads, sidewalks, waterways, alleys, parks, etc and have been witness to an inordinate amount of locals tossing trash all over the place.  I even saw to the horror of myself and other foreign tourists, a passing motorbike driver tossing a bag of garbage over a bridge into a river!  WTF!!!  Sure India is still developing and I can understand that.  I just hope India realizes soon how litter detracts from the beauty of its country and of its people.
